Output d99f04794874599e6465f5fef684320dd6f8dde5a179e828549ca65c2fba4f86:17

value
175572136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1583b02142d9ba0280f8fcdf59c1bfa05aae327 OP_EQUAL
address
3Lmvqztk6Ck9hgDU4A15eK7Bdhut4rnuxT
transaction
d99f04794874599e6465f5fef684320dd6f8dde5a179e828549ca65c2fba4f86
spent
true